Rich History

Lubbock has a rich history that dates back to the 1800s. It was founded as a ranching and farming community and has grown into a thriving city with a strong cultural identity. Visitors can explore the city’s history at the National Ranching Heritage Center, which features historic ranch buildings and exhibits. The Buddy Holly Center is another popular attraction and pays tribute to Lubbock’s most famous native son, Buddy Holly. The center features artifacts and exhibits that showcase the life and legacy of the iconic musician.

Thriving Arts and Culture Scene

Lubbock has a thriving arts and culture scene that celebrates the city’s unique identity. The Lubbock Cultural District is a must-visit destination and is home to several museums and galleries, including the Museum of Texas Tech University and the Charles Adams Gallery. Visitors can also explore the city’s public art installations, which can be found throughout the downtown area.

The city is also known for its live music scene, with several venues offering performances throughout the year. The Lubbock Symphony Orchestra and Ballet Lubbock both offer performances that showcase the city’s cultural diversity.

Outdoor Adventures

In addition to its cultural offerings, Lubbock also offers plenty of opportunities for outdoor adventures. The city is home to several parks, including the Lubbock Lake Landmark, which features walking trails and a natural history museum. Visitors can also go hiking, camping, or fishing at Buffalo Springs Lake or enjoy a round of golf at one of the city’s many golf courses.

Festivals and Events

Lubbock hosts several festivals and events throughout the year that showcase the city’s unique identity. The Lubbock Arts Festival, held in April, features live music, art exhibits, and hands-on art activities. The National Cowboy Symposium and Celebration, held in September, celebrates the history and culture of the American West with music, poetry, and cowboy demonstrations.
